The demand factor formula is simple but very important. Demand factor is the ratio of the sum of the maximum demand of a system (or part of a system) to the total connected load on the system (or part of the system) under consideration. Df = maximum demand/connected load The demand factor is a security parameter within the electrical distribution system that signifies the quantity of power necessary for a system to work at its peak load. Demand factor is the ratio between maximum demand to the connected load on a power system.
